TP and spouse go to the marketplace

Jan, Feb, March both names on 1095 and numbers same for these 3 months

April - Oct both names, monthly prem higher, but same for all months

Nov - only husband's name premium looks like just for him (about half)

Dec both names again, prem back up, but not the same as the first of the year.

They rec'd 4 1095. In Sept, had a child, but child got put on state insurance (Medicaid)

Couple makes $44000.

Do I put all four on the same 8962, the software calculates a repayment to IRS

then put the wife on the 8965 showing no insurance for 1 month? with a small penalty?

on the 1095's - all are put on one sheet? As I read, I do not put totals into lines 11 since insurance wasn't the same all year?

 

 

It sounds like you are now asking about the 8962 to reconcile the PTC since since referenced line 11 and having more than one 1095.  If that is the case, because you have more than one 1095 and the amounts are not the same for every month of the year on all of them, you must use the monthly input section that begins on line 12.   The instructions for form 8962 include detailed instructions, starting on page 10, of what to enter in each column from the 1095s. It might be as simply as adding them together, BUT it can be more complicated depending on several more factors.
